Re: Rare '37 luggage rack on EBAY
I've had a couple of NOS '37 racks over the years, but like John, without the brackets, which were originally sold separately depending on body type. Years ago there was a fellow in northeastern Ohio who was reproducing the brackets, but he had to give it up due to failing health. I've not seen any original or reproduction brackets since, but then again I might not recognize them beyond what is shown on page 218 of the DeAngelis/Francis book.
The brackets with the rack on ebay do not look exactly like those in the book photo, but it's hard to tell with certainty. As Ford did not manufacture the racks that it sold, those may or may not be for a Ford. I hope someone with certain knowledge will enlighten us. Last edited by DavidG; 06-26-2018 at 09:53 AM. |

Re: Rare '37 luggage rack on EBAY
Those four holes are to secure a trunk on the rack with bolts through the bottom of the trunk. Other than the non-rack-based Potter trunks for the '33-'34, the last U.S. Ford-released trunk for use on a rack was in the 1932 model year. As the rack portion itself was carried over for the '33 and early '34 models, the '32 trunk fit those racks as well.
